Pls Help with Examples:'Error on the face of record'

What is  'Errors (of law, procedure, facts) apparent on the face of the record'

 

 

Can anybody give good examples of the above which are accepted, so far, by hon courts in India, in  'review' as well as 'judicial review' proceedings.

 

 

A few things which are said about above are as:-

 

1. Error should be glaring, self evident, manifest and does not require a long drawn process to explain.

2. Also It should not look like an 'appeal in disguise' directly.

3. OR There must be an occurance of wrongly used jurisdiction (either underused or exceeded in it)

 

 

But unfortunately there are no good examples available, of such 'errors on the face of record'!! 

 

 

Almost all citations seems to be only narrating the above worn-out definition of 'Error .........'

 

But at the end, all these citations opine that 'it doesn't look like an Error on the face of record' ....then what looks like 'an error on the face of record'?

 

 

 

Also .............Is it an Error committed by other party or .................. an Error committed by  the Hon'ble Court?
